Good Molecules Squalane Oil is a lightweight, fast-absorbing facial oil made from 100% plant-derived olive squalane. It provides deep hydration, antioxidant protection, and supports skin’s natural moisture balance without clogging pores. Suitable for all skin types, it also nourishes hair and nails, making it a versatile addition to any modern skincare routine.

I bought this for facial Gua sha after several other “sensitive skin friendly” oils caused closed comedones. No issues with this, takes about 4 drops for full coverage of face and neck, skin feels great after! I can’t use heavy moisturizer, so I’ve been adding a drop to my gel moisturizer for added hydration. Works great!
